Arcontech links with Radianz to create market data network

Real-time market data specialist Arcontech is to offer its products over the Radianz network under an initiative that will allow institutions to create shared networks of data that cut out information vendors such as Reuters, Bloomberg and MoneyLine Telerate.

Under the arrangement, Arcontech's CityVision StarNet software will be used over RadianzNet to create data sub networks connecting producers and consumers of real-time market data. Firms may use the network to outsource their data contributions infrastructure, as a direct distribution channel to end users, or to create data sharing communities that bypass traditional information providers.

Andrew Miller, managing director of London-based Arcontech, says that there have been attempts to establish such networks before, notably for replacement of vendors' closed-user groups using the Internet. "The beauty of this deal is that is removes the key obstacle that has hampered deployment in the past – the lack of reliable, high-performance bandwidth," he says. "Although StarNet works well over the public Internet, there's not much in the way of service level guarantees available out there."

Myron Tataryn, head of European sales at Reuters/Equant subsidiary Radianz, comments: "Whilst Radianz remains neutral concerning the services and suppliers we support, clearly it makes sense to work with companies whose products add value to our own offerings. Arcontech has some interesting technology in its CityVision StarNet range that fit well with our model. The combination allows for rapid delivery of selective real-time channels between any or all of our 9000+ customer locations - a true market data community."
